Understanding Window Replacement Costs: What You’re Really Investing In

Before diving into financing options, it’s crucial to understand what drives window replacement costs. The average homeowner spends between $300 to $1,000 per window, though premium options can reach $1,500 or more. These costs reflect materials, labor, permits, and the long-term value you’re adding to your home.

Quality windows typically pay for themselves through energy savings over 10-15 years. Modern double or triple-pane windows can reduce heating and cooling costs by 15-30%, making them an investment rather than just an expense. Factor in increased home value, improved comfort, and reduced maintenance needs, and the financial picture becomes even more compelling.

The key is finding financing that aligns with these long-term benefits while fitting your current cash flow situation.

Traditional Financing Routes: Time-Tested Solutions

Home Equity Loans and Lines of Credit

Home equity financing remains one of the most popular choices for window replacement projects. If you’ve built substantial equity in your home, these options typically offer competitive interest rates and tax-deductible interest payments for qualified improvements.

Home equity loans provide a lump sum with fixed monthly payments, making budgeting straightforward. Meanwhile, home equity lines of credit (HELOCs) offer flexibility, allowing you to draw funds as needed during your project. This approach works particularly well for phased window replacements or when you’re unsure about final costs.

The main consideration? Your home serves as collateral, so careful financial planning is essential.

Personal Loans: Quick Access Without Home Risk

Personal loans have gained popularity for home improvements due to their speed and simplicity. Many lenders now offer specialized home improvement personal loans with competitive rates for borrowers with good credit.

These unsecured loans typically range from $5,000 to $50,000, covering most window replacement projects. The application process is often streamlined, with funding available within days rather than weeks. Since your home isn’t collateral, you maintain full ownership security while accessing needed funds.

Interest rates vary based on creditworthiness, but they’re often reasonable for borrowers with scores above 650.

Contractor-Sponsored Financing Programs

Many window replacement companies now partner with financing institutions to offer direct customer financing. These programs can be incredibly convenient, allowing you to secure both your contractor and funding through a single process.

Contractor financing often includes promotional offers like zero-percent interest for qualified periods, deferred payment options, or extended repayment terms. Some programs cater specifically to different credit levels, ensuring options for various financial situations.

The application process typically happens during your consultation, with instant or same-day approval decisions. This streamlined approach can be particularly valuable when dealing with emergency window replacements or tight project timelines.

Always compare contractor financing terms with independent options to ensure you’re getting competitive rates and favorable conditions.

Government Programs and Incentives

Energy Efficiency Rebates and Tax Credits

Federal, state, and local governments often provide financial incentives for energy-efficient window installations. The federal Residential Energy Efficiency Tax Credit can cover up to 30% of qualifying window costs, significantly reducing your effective investment.

Many utility companies offer additional rebates for Energy Star certified windows, sometimes providing several hundred dollars per window. These programs recognize that efficient windows reduce overall energy demand, benefiting both homeowners and the broader electrical grid.

Local municipalities may offer additional incentives, particularly in areas focused on energy conservation or historic preservation. Research available programs in your area before finalizing your financing strategy.

FHA Title I Loans

The Federal Housing Administration’s Title I program provides government-backed loans specifically for home improvements. These loans can cover up to $25,000 for window replacement and other qualifying improvements, often with competitive rates and flexible qualification requirements.

Title I loans don’t require home equity and feature streamlined approval processes. They’re particularly valuable for homeowners who might not qualify for traditional financing or prefer not to use their home as collateral.

Creative Financing Solutions for Tight Budgets

Manufacturer Financing Programs

Major window manufacturers increasingly offer direct consumer financing to support their dealer networks. These programs often feature competitive terms, including promotional periods with reduced or zero interest rates.

Manufacturer financing can be particularly attractive because it’s designed specifically for window purchases, with terms that reflect the product’s longevity and energy savings potential. Some programs even tie financing terms to energy efficiency ratings, rewarding customers who choose higher-performance windows.

Credit Card Options and Promotional Offers

While not always the most economical long-term solution, credit cards can provide immediate financing for window replacement projects. Many cards offer promotional periods with zero-percent interest for 12-24 months, which can work well for smaller projects or when combined with other funding sources.

Home improvement credit cards, specifically designed for renovation projects, often provide extended promotional periods and higher credit limits than general-purpose cards. Some even offer additional benefits like purchase protection or extended warranties on home improvement purchases.

The key is ensuring you can pay off the balance before promotional rates expire, as standard credit card interest rates can be significantly higher than other financing options.

Rent-to-Own and Lease Programs

For homeowners facing immediate window needs but limited financing options, some companies offer rent-to-own or lease programs. These arrangements allow you to install new windows immediately while making monthly payments over extended periods.

While these programs typically cost more over time than traditional financing, they can provide solutions when other options aren’t available. They’re particularly useful for emergency situations where waiting for traditional loan approval isn’t practical.

Carefully review terms and total costs, as these programs can be significantly more expensive than conventional financing over the full payment period.

Choosing the Right Financing Option for Your Situation

Selecting the best financing approach depends on several factors: your credit score, available home equity, project timeline, and personal financial preferences. Start by evaluating your creditworthiness and available equity, as these factors will largely determine which options offer the most favorable terms.

Consider the project’s urgency. Emergency replacements might favor quick-approval options like personal loans or contractor financing, while planned upgrades allow time to explore all available programs and incentives.

Don’t forget to factor in the total cost of financing, including interest, fees, and any promotional period limitations. Sometimes a slightly higher interest rate with better terms or flexibility can be more valuable than the lowest available rate.

Tips for Securing the Best Financing Terms

Preparation is key to securing favorable financing terms. Start by checking your credit report and addressing any issues before applying. Even small improvements in your credit score can result in significantly better interest rates.

Shop around and compare multiple offers. Financing terms can vary considerably between lenders, and the first option you encounter may not be the best available. Don’t hesitate to negotiate or ask about available promotions.

Consider timing your application strategically. Some programs offer seasonal promotions, and your personal financial situation might be stronger at certain times of the year.

Finally, read all terms carefully and ask questions about anything you don’t understand. The cheapest option isn’t always the best if it comes with restrictive terms or hidden fees.

Frequently Asked Questions

What credit score do I need for window replacement financing?
Most financing options are available with credit scores of 600 or higher, though the best terms typically require scores above 650. Some contractor and manufacturer programs work with lower scores, while government programs like FHA Title I loans have more flexible requirements.

Can I finance window replacement with no money down?
Yes, many financing options require no down payment, including personal loans, contractor financing programs, and some home equity lines of credit. However, making a down payment can often secure better interest rates and reduce monthly payments.

How long do window replacement loans typically last?
Loan terms vary widely, from 2-7 years for personal loans to 15-30 years for home equity loans. Contractor financing often offers 5-12 year terms, while some manufacturer programs provide extended repayment periods up to 20 years for larger projects.

Are there tax benefits for financing window replacement?
Interest on home equity loans and HELOCs used for qualifying home improvements is typically tax-deductible. Additionally, energy-efficient windows may qualify for federal tax credits and local rebates, effectively reducing your total project cost.

What happens if I can’t make my window financing payments?
Consequences depend on your financing type. Secured loans (like home equity products) could put your home at risk, while unsecured personal loans typically result in credit score damage and potential collection actions. Most lenders offer hardship programs or payment modifications for temporary financial difficulties.

Can I pay off window financing early without penalties?
Most modern financing options allow early payoff without penalties, but always confirm this before signing. Some promotional programs may have specific terms about early payment, particularly those offering deferred interest periods.
